brush |
a tool for cleaning, painting, and other things. It has a handle and a tight group of stiff fibers on one end. |
cave |
a large, natural hole in rock or under the earth. A cave is big enough for a person or animal to enter. |
cradle |
a small bed for a baby that can move from side to side. |
dine |
to eat a meal, usually in a formal way. |
instrument |
a tool or mechanical device used for special work. |
lazy |
not wanting to work or use effort. |
lose |
to no longer have something because you do not know where it is. |
moist |
a little bit wet. |
mountain |
a land mass with great height and steep sides. It is much higher than a hill. |
movement |
a motion or way of moving. |
rule |
a law or direction that guides behavior or action. |
self |
one's own being, character, and nature. |
spark |
a very small bit of hot and glowing material thrown off by burning wood. |
stormy |
having or characterized by storms. |
team |
a group formed to play or work together. |
